< Galatians 3 >
1 O senseless Galatians, who hath bewitched you that you should not obey the truth, before whose eyes Jesus Christ hath been set forth, crucified among you?
O Galatiano çoroác, norc encantatu çaituztéz eguia obedi ezteçaçuen? ceiney beguién aitzinean lehenetic representatu içan baitzaiçue Iesus Christ, çuen artean crucificatua?
2 This only would I learn of you: Did you receive the Spirit by the works of the law, or by the hearing of faith?
Haur solament iaquin nahi dut çuetaric, Legueco obréz Spiritu saindua recebitu vkan duçue, ala fedearen predicationeaz?
3 Are you so foolish, that, whereas you began in the Spirit, you would now be made perfect by the flesh?
Hain çoro çarete, Spirituaz hassiric, orain haraguiaz acaba deçaçuen?
4 Have you suffered so great things in vain? If it be yet in vain.
Alfer hambat suffritu vkan duçue? baldin alfer-ere bada.
5 He therefore who giveth to you the Spirit, and worketh miracles among you; doth he do it by the works of the law, or by the hearing of the faith?
Bada, Spiritua çuey fornitzen drauçuenac, eta verthuteac çuetan obratzen dituenac, Legueco obréz eguiten du, ala fedearen predicationeaz?
6 As it is written: Abraham believed God, and it was reputed to him unto justice.
7 Know ye therefore, that they who are of faith, the same are the children of Abraham.
8 And the scripture, foreseeing, that God justifieth the Gentiles by faith, told unto Abraham before: In thee shall all nations be blessed.
Eta Scripturác aitzinetic ikussiric ecen fedeaz Iaincoac iustificatzen dituela Gentilac, aitzinetic euangelizatu vkan drauca Abrahami, cioela, Benedicatuac içanen dituc hitan Gende guciac.
9 Therefore they that are of faith, shall be blessed with faithful Abraham.
Bada, fedezcoac benedicatzen dirade Abraham fidelarequin.
10 For as many as are of the works of the law, are under a curse. For it is written: Cursed is every one, that abideth not in all things, which are written in the book of the law to do them.
Ecen norere Legueco obretaric baitirade, maledictionearen azpian dirade: ecen scribatua da, Maradicatua da norere ezpaita egonen Legueco liburän scribatuac diraden gauça gucietan, hec eguin ditzançát.
11 But that in the law no man is justified with God, it is manifest: because the just man liveth by faith.
Eta Legueaz nehor eztela iustificatzen Iaincoa baithan, gauça claroa da: ecen iustoa fedez vicico da.
12 But the law is not of faith: but, He that doth those things, shall live in them.
Eta Leguea ezta fedetic: baina gauça hec eguinen dituen guiçona, vicico da hetan.
13 Christ hath redeemed us from the curse of the law, being made a curse for us: for it is written: Cursed is every one that hangeth on a tree:
Baina Christec redemitu vkan gaitu Leguearen maledictionetic, bera guregatic maledictione eguin içanic: (ecen scribatua da, Maradicatua da çurean vrkatua den gucia)
14 That the blessing of Abraham might come on the Gentiles through Christ Jesus: that we may receive the promise of the Spirit by faith.
Abrahamen benedictionea Gentiletara hel ledinçát Iesus Christez, eta Spirituaren promessa fedez recebi deçagunçát.
15 Brethren (I speak after the manner of man, ) yet a man’s testament, if it be confirmed, no man despiseth, nor addeth to it.
Anayeác, guiçonén ançora minço naiz, Appoinctamendubat guiçon-batena badere, authoritatez confirmatua bada, nehorc eztu hausten ez emendatzen.
16 To Abraham were the promises made and to his seed. He saith not, And to his seeds, as of many: but as of one, And to thy seed, which is Christ.
Abrahami bada promessac erran içan çaizquio, eta haren haciari. Eztu erraiten, Eta haciey, anhitzez minço baliz beçala: baina batez beçala, Eta hire haciari, cein baita Christ.
17 Now this I say, that the testament which was confirmed by God, the law which was made after four hundred and thirty years, doth not disannul, to make the promise of no effect.
Haur bada diot, lehenetic Iaincoaz Christen respectuz confirmatu içan den alliançá, laur-ehun eta hoguey eta hamar vrtheren buruän ethorri içan den Legueac eztuela hausten, promessa aboli deçançát.
18 For if the inheritance be of the law, it is no more of promise. But God gave it to Abraham by promise.
Ecen baldin heretagea Leguetic bada, ez ia promessetic: baina Abrahami promessetic eman vkan drauca Iaincoac.
19 Why then was the law? It was set because of transgressions, until the seed should come, to whom he made the promise, being ordained by angels in the hand of a mediator.
Certaco da beraz Leguea? Transgressionén causaz eratchequi içan da, ethor leiteno haci hura ceini promessa eguin içan baitzayó, eta Leguea ordenatu içan da Aingueruéz, Ararteco baten escuz.
20 Now a mediator is not of one: but God is one.
Eta Arartecoa ezta batena: baina Iaincoa bat da.
21 Was the law then against the promises of God? God forbid. For if there had been a law given which could give life, verily justice should have been by the law.
Leguea beraz Iaincoaren promessén contra eratchequi içan da? Guertha eztadila. Ecen eman içan baliz Leguea ceinec viuifica ahal leçan, segur Leguetic liçate iustitiá.
22 But the scripture hath concluded all under sin, that the promise, by the faith of Jesus Christ, might be given to them that believe.
Baina ertsi vkan du Scripturác gucia bekatuaren azpian, promessa Iesus Christen fedeaz eman lequiençát sinhesten duteney.
23 But before the faith came, we were kept under the law shut up, unto that faith which was to be revealed.
Bada fedea ethor cedin baino lehen, Leguearen azpian beguiratzen guinen ertsiac reuelatzeco cen federa heltzeco.
24 Wherefore the law was our pedagogue in Christ, that we might be justified by faith.
Bada, Leguea gure pedagogo içan da Christgana, fedez iustifica guentecençát.
25 But after the faith is come, we are no longer under a pedagogue.
Baina fedea ethorriz gueroztic, ezgara guehiagoric pedagogoren azpian.
26 For you are all the children of God by faith, in Christ Jesus.
Ecen guciác Iaincoaren haour çarete Iesus Christ baithango fedeaz.
27 For as many of you as have been baptized in Christ, have put on Christ.
Ecen batheyatu içan çareten guciéc Christ iaunci vkan duçue.
28 There is neither Jew nor Greek: there is neither bond nor free: there is neither male nor female. For you are all one in Christ Jesus.
Ezta Iuduric ez Grecquic, ezta sclaboric ez libreric, ezta arric ez emeric: ecen çuec gucioc bat çarete Iesus Christean.
29 And if you be Christ’s, then are you the seed of Abraham, heirs according to the promise.
Eta baldin çuec Christenac baçarete, beraz Abrahamen haci çarete, eta promessaren arauez heredero.
